Hayners Sports Barn Hayners Sports Barn offers private training in baseball and softball; as well as the space for teams The Sports Barn/Hayner Academy exists to:
1.

Promote and advance the great games of baseball and softball.

2. Equip players, parents and coaches of all age groups with the necessary resources to maximize each individual's God given ability and overall enjoyment of the game.

3. Positively impact individuals, families and culture beyond the playing field as we set about accomplishing the aforementioned. Furthermore, we believe:
That particip

ation in sports is a great way for kids to have fun, stay healthy, build character and learn life lessons. It is our aim to create an environment where kids can thrive.

Hayner Academy congratulates former Barnstormers Pitcher Daniel Cohen for an excellent 4-year career at Yale University that has culminated in his Bulldogs competing this weekend in the Eugene (Oregon) NCAA Div. I Regional. For his career thus far, Daniel has pitched 227 innings with a career 15-15 record and an excellent 170/94 strikeouts to walk ratio.

Yale will play second-seeded Oregon State in their second game of the double elimination tournament on Saturday afternoon. The Bulldogs lost to top-seeded Oregon ( #11 rank) on Friday evening 14-2.

Hayner Academy extends best wishes to current Barnstormers 16U Pitching Coach Ryan McCarroll & former Barnstormers pitcher Michael Mack as their Northeastern University baseball team (38-20) heads to Lawrence, Kansas for the NCAA Lawrence Regional beginning this Friday, May 29th. The Huskies, the regional’s #4 seed, will open play against 15th-nationally seeded and top-regional seed Kansas today at 12 p.m. #2 seed Arkansas and #3 seed Missouri State round out the four-team, double-elimination field at Hoglund Ballpark and will play Friday night. Baseball is a great game—and for many players, the love for it starts young. Ours did.

We grew up playing every chance we got with neighborhood kids, building our own fields and learning simply by playing. No coaches. No travel teams. Just baseball, repetition, and a whole lot of fun. Those endless hours are what made us better—and they’re what kids still need today.

Times have changed, and consistent practice is harder to come by. Hitting, throwing, and catching take repetition, instruction, and confidence.

That’s why we’re excited to offer our Spring Break Baseball Camp—five straight days of focused skill development for players ages 8–12. Think spring training, just like the pros.

****Hayner’s announces opening of Steep’d Coffee House!

Who: Craig and Carolyn Hayner, Jeremy Herrey and James Dowen

What: The opening of Steep’d Coffee House at Hayner’s!

Where: Hayner’s Ice Cream and Country Store, 148 Route 236, Halfmoon, NY 12065

When: Soft Opening, Monday April 6th 7am to 3pm

Craig and Carolyn Hayner, owners of Hayner Farm Stand and Old-Fashioned Country Store, LLC (AKA Hayner’s Ice Cream and Country store) are pleased announce the opening of Steep’d Coffee House @ Hayner’s this Monday, April 6th at 7am.

The highly anticipated opening announced in January this year will bring together a combination of past, present and new menu highlights. Featuring an extensive line of coffee, tea and lattes. A wholesome breakfast and lunch menu, mouthwatering pastries, homemade soups and more.

“We are excited to be teaming up with Jeremy Herrey and James Dowen to offer a full-service, year-round café experience. Jeremy and James bring creative energy, culinary expertise and the necessary foodservice experience to bring this exciting collaboration to fruition. We believe customers will be thrilled to enjoy a delicious breakfast sandwich or a pastry and coffee in our dining room, on the go, or outside against the beautiful backdrop of the Hayner Farm. People have asked us over the years, when are you bringing this back? We are excited to see this concept come full circle from where it all began twenty-eight years ago, plus more!” said Carolyn Hayner.

“When we first opened our doors in 1998, building off my dad’s farmstand business, we were blessed to have the opportunity to create a restaurant café business right here on the Hayner farm where I grew up. Over the years, as food service trends and demographics have changed in our area (especially with the addition of the town park next door), we adjusted our business plan accordingly. Often making hard decisions to change our menu offerings to meet demand for our most popular products due to our limited space. Last year, with the expansion of our building to create a dedicated area for ice cream, we can continue bringing back some of our most popular menu concepts of the past along with exciting new modern twists for today.” said Craig Hayner.

“Our motto is “made with love and excellence,” said Jeremy Herrey, who along with James Dowen will operate the day-to-day business operations of Steep’d Coffehouse @ Hayner’s. “We love our community and are excited for this opportunity to partner with Carolyn and Craig, who have established an incredible following over the years. Not only will we continue their legacy of serving quality products with great service, but we will extend them as well. Our beverage section will feature past favorites such as Snickerdoodle coffee, but also include an extensive variety of coffees, espresso drinks, lattes and more. There will be 14 crafted teas along with several matcha options made with premium Jade leaf Matcha. Our authentic masala chai latte will be made from scratch with fresh spices and fine tea. We will offer an array of wholesome food items like breakfast sandwiches on freshly baked breads, French Toast using Madagascar vanilla and real maple syrup, several panini, sandwich and salad options, along with homemade quiches, soups, scones and more. All products will be made with fresh quality ingredients with many gluten free and vegan options as well”.

The soft opening for Steep’d Coffee House will be Monday, April 6th from 7am to 3pm. Business hours for April will be 7am to 3pm daily, closed Tuesdays.

May hours, beginning Friday May 1st (Opening Day for Hayner’s Ice Cream)
Steep’d Coffee House - open daily, 7 days a week from 7am to 8pm.
Hayner’s Ice Cream – open daily, 7 days a week from 12 noon to 9pm.
The Hayner Farm Stand will open around mid-July (crop dependent) featuring our Hayner Farm grown sweetcorn and more.

“We look forward to seeing everyone soon as we celebrate our 28th year in business! Thank you to all our wonderful customers, employees (past and present), suppliers and all who have made this dream a reality over the years. Especially our parents, Harvey and Carol Hayner, who always believed in and supported our efforts. We love our hometown of Halfmoon and all our surrounding communities” said Craig and Carolyn Hayner.
